一键配置VPS怎么实现?_详解三种高效方法与常见问题解决方案
如何通过一键脚本快速配置VPS服务器环境?
| 配置工具 | 适用系统 | 主要功能 | 安装方式 |
|---|---|---|---|
| 宝塔面板 | CentOS/Ubuntu | WEB环境管理、文件管理 | yum install -y wget && wget -O install.sh http://download.bt.cn/install/install_6.0.sh && bash install.sh |
| vpstoolbox | Debian/Ubuntu | 全能服务器环境 | apt update && apt-get install sudo curl screen -y && curl -LO https://raw.githubusercontent.com/johnrosen1/vpstoolbox/master/vps.sh && sudo screen -U bash vps.sh |
| qBitTorrent-docker | Linux | 离线下载服务 | Docker部署 |
枣庄正规SEO优化如何选择?_ - 明确约定服务周期、效果指标和违约责任
# 一键配置VPS的完整指南
对于许多初次使用VPS的用户来说,服务器环境的配置往往是一个技术门槛。传统的手动配置方式需要逐条输入命令,不仅耗时耗力,还容易出错。幸运的是,现在有多种一键配置工具可以简化这个过程。
## 主要配置方法概览
| 方法类型 | 适用场景 | 优势 | 代表工具 |
|---|---|---|---|
| 面板工具 | 网站建设、可视化操作 | 图形界面友好,功能全面 | 宝塔面板 |
| 脚本工具 | 批量部署、自动化运维 | 执行效率高,可定制性强 | vpstoolbox |
| 镜像模板 | 快速建站、应用部署 | 开箱即用,无需配置 | 腾讯云WordPress镜像 |
## 详细操作流程
### 方法一:使用宝塔面板配置
**操作说明**:宝塔面板是一款流行的服务器管理软件,提供Web端图形化界面,适合管理网站、数据库、FTP等服务。
**使用工具提示**:建议使用CentOS 7及以上系统,兼容性最佳。
```bash
# 安装宝塔面板
yum install -y wget && wget -O install.sh http://download.bt.cn/install/install_6.0.sh && bash install.sh
```
安装过程中,系统会显示安装进度,完成后会提供面板访问地址、用户名和密码。
### 方法二:使用vpstoolbox脚本
**操作说明**:vpstoolbox是一个全功能的服务器环境配置脚本,支持Nginx、PHP、MySQL等服务的自动安装和配置。
**使用工具提示**:仅支持Debian/Ubuntu系统,需要root权限。
```bash
# 一键安装vpstoolbox
apt -o Acquire::AllowInsecureRepositories=true -o Acquire::AllowDowngradeToInsecureRepositories=true update && apt-get install sudo curl screen -y && curl -LO https://raw.githubusercontent.com/johnrosen1/vpstoolbox/master/vps.sh && sudo screen -U bash vps.sh
```
执行后脚本会自动检测系统环境,并提示选择需要安装的服务组件。
### 方法三:使用SSH远程连接
**操作说明**:在开始任何配置之前,首先需要连接到VPS服务器。
**使用工具提示**:推荐使用WindTerm、MobaXterm或PuTTY等SSH客户端工具。
```bash
# SSH连接命令格式
ssh root@你的VPS_IP地址
# 首次连接后建议立即更新系统
sudo apt update && sudo apt upgrade -y
```
浙江SEO网络推广咨询价格一般是多少?_ - 企业官网优化比电商平台简单,价格低30%左右
## 常见问题与解决方案
| 问题 | 原因 | 解决方案 |
|---|---|---|
| 无法通过SSH连接VPS | 防火墙限制、SSH服务未启动、网络连接问题 | 1. 检查本地网络连接2. 联系VPS服务商查询网络状态3. 使用traceroute诊断网络路径 |
| VPS性能缓慢或服务崩溃 | 资源超限(CPU、内存、磁盘I/O) | 1. 使用htop监控资源使用情况2. 优化应用程序配置3. 考虑升级VPS配置 |
| 网站或服务无法访问 | 端口未开放、服务配置错误、DNS解析问题 | 1. 检查防火墙规则2. 确认相关服务状态3. 验证DNS设置是否正确 |
| 系统安全漏洞 | 未及时更新补丁、弱密码、配置不当 | 1. 定期更新系统和软件2. 设置强密码并启用密钥登录 |
| 数据丢失风险 | 缺乏备份策略、磁盘故障 | 1. 制定定期备份计划2. 使用快照功能3. 重要数据多地备份 |
通过上述方法和工具,即使是VPS新手也能快速完成服务器环境的配置。选择适合自己需求的方法,可以大大提升配置效率和成功率。
发表评论